Bachelor of Commerce/Bachelor of Laws

Students will gain the skills and knowledge to become a confident, ethical lawyer who can make a real contribution to the legal profession and the community. And by pairing law with commerce, they can expand their career outcomes to gain professional accreditation in human resource management, accounting, marketing and law. Throughout this double degree students gain hands-on experience – such as mooting competitions and pro bono placements. While studying commerce, they will take part in community and industry placements.
